Muistiinpano
Tämän sivun käyttö edellyttää valtuutusta. Voit yrittää kirjautua sisään tai vaihtaa hakemistoa.
Tämän sivun käyttö edellyttää valtuutusta. Voit yrittää vaihtaa hakemistoa.
Huomautus
Dynamics 365 Commerce Retail Interest Group on siirtynyt Yammerista Viva Engage. Jos uuden Viva Engage -yhteisön käyttöoikeus puuttuu, täytä tämä lomake (https://aka.ms/JoinD365commerceVivaEngageCommunity), jotta sinut lisätään yhteisöön ja pääset osallistumaan uusimpiin keskusteluihin.
Tässä artikkelissa kuvataan Adventure Works -teeman asentaminen Microsoft Dynamics 365 Commerce.
Tärkeää
Adventure Works -teema ja -moduulit ovat käytettävissä Dynamics 365 Commerce 10.0.20 -versiosta alkaen. Voit hankkia ne Microsoft Marketplacesta.
Vaatimukset
Ennen kuin asennat Adventure Works -teeman, varmista, että käytössäsi on Dynamics 365 Commerce ympäristö (Commerce-versio 10.0.20 tai uudempi), joka sisältää Retail Cloud Scale Unitin (RCSU), Commerce Online Software Development Kitin (SDK) ja Commerce Module -kirjaston. Lisätietoja Commerce SDK:n ja moduulikirjaston asentamisesta on kohdassa Kehitysympäristön määrittäminen.
Asennusvaiheet
Adventure Works -teeman asentaminen sovellukseen
Dynamics365-commerce-syöte tarjoaa Adventure Works -teemapaketin @msdyn365-commerce-theme/adventureworks-theme-kit. Paketti käyttää kuitenkin eri nimitilaa. Siksi sinun on lisättävä rekisterimerkinnät nimitilaan.
Päivitä .npmrc-tiedosto sisältämään seuraava rekisterimerkintä (jos merkintä ei vielä sisälly):
@msdyn365-commerce-theme:registry=https://pkgs.dev.azure.com/commerce-partner/Registry/_packaging/dynamics365-commerce/npm/registry/Päivitä .yarnrc-tiedosto sisältämään seuraava rekisterimerkintä (jos merkintä ei vielä sisälly):
"@msdyn365-commerce-theme:registry" "https://pkgs.dev.azure.com/commerce-partner/Registry/_packaging/dynamics365-commerce/npm/registry/"
Jos haluat asentaa paketin paikalliseen ympäristöösi, suorita yarn add THEME_PACKAGE@VERSION komento komentokehotteesta. Korvaa THEME_PACKAGE teemapaketin nimellä (@msdyn365-commerce-theme/adventureworks-theme-kit) ja VERSIO käyttämälläsi moduulikirjaston versionumerolla. Varmista, että teemapaketin ja moduulikirjaston versiot vastaavat toisiaan. Löydät oikean moduulikirjaston versionumeron avaamalla package.json tiedoston ja etsimällä aloituspaketin arvon riippuvuusosiosta . Seuraavassa esimerkissä package.json tiedosto käyttää moduulikirjaston versiota 9.32, joka yhdistää Dynamics 365 Commerce 10.0.22 -versioon.
"dependencies": {
"@msdyn365-commerce-modules/starter-pack": "9.32",
}
Seuraavassa esimerkissä kerrotaan, miten Adventure Works -aiheen versio 9.32 lisättiin yarn add-komennolla. Komento päivittää package.json-tiedoston automaattisesti niin, että se sisältää riippuvuuden.
yarn add @msdyn365-commerce-theme/adventureworks-theme-kit@9.32
Lue lisätietoja moduulikirjaston version päivittämisestä kohdasta SDK:n ja moduuliskirjaston päivitykset.
Tärkeää
- Moduulikirjaston version tulisi olla sama kuin teeman version, jotta kaikki toiminnot toimivat odotetulla tavalla.
- Commerce-moduulikirjaston ja SDK:n minimiversion tulee olla 10.0.20 (9.31).
Adventure Works -teeman fonttitiedostojen lisääminen
Kun olet asentanut Adventure Works -teeman sovellukseesi, lisää vaaditut fonttitiedostot. Suorita tämä vaihe kopioimalla kaikki fonttitiedostot kohteesta \node_modules@msdyn365-commerce-theme\adventureworks-theme-kit\src\modules\adventureworks\public\webfonts kumppanisovelluksen julkiseen hakemistopolkuun \public\webfonts.
Adventure Works -teeman resurssien määritys
Päivitä teeman oletusresurssi. Suorita tämä vaihe kopioimalla sisältö tiedostosta global.json kohdasta \node_modules@msdyn365-commerce-theme\adventureworks-theme-kit\src\modules\adventureworks\resources\modules kumppanisovellustiedostoon global.json kohdassa \src\resources\modules. Jos \src\resources-kohdehakemistoa ei ole, voit kopioida sen kokonaan \node_modules@msdyn365-commerce-theme\adventureworks-theme-kit\src\modules\adventureworks-lähdehakemistosta\src-kohdehakemistoon .
Päivitysten hakeminen ja teeman oikeellisuustarkistus
Lisätietoja uusimman SDK:n, moduulikirjaston ja muiden riippuvuuspäivitysten hakemisesta on SDK:n ja moduulikirjaston päivitysten "Hae päivitykset" -osassa.
Kun olet tehnyt uusimmat riippuvuudet, käynnistä Node-palvelin kehitysympäristössäsi suorittamalla yarn-aloituskomento ja testaa uutta Adventure Works -teemaa. Selaa sovellusta paikallisesti kyselyn merkkijonoparametrin ?theme=adventureworks avulla (esimerkiksi https://localhost:4000/?theme=adventureworks).